Oyster plates, platters, and servers produced in porcelain, majolica, faïence, English ironstone, and French stoneware are displayed in over 475 beautiful color photographs. Ranging from the elegant to the everyday, these plates date from the mid-nineteenth century through the late-twentieth century. The informative and interesting text includes histories of the major oyster plate manufacturers (including Minton, Wedgwood, Haviland, and the Quimper potteries, among others) whose wears are on display. Also included are an examination of manufacturer's marks, - a discussion of the ceramic and glass oyster plate forms and decoration, and - market values in the captions, plus - an extensive bibliography and an index. Jeffrey B. Snyder is an experienced writer, editor, and public speaker. He has discussed antiques on radio and television. He has appeared several times on Martha Stewart Living and on WHYY TV's PBS special Philadelphia: Workshop of the World .
